Unveiling the Legacy of C.S. Osborne & Co.: A Story of Excellence and Innovation
Founded in 1826 by Charles Samuel Osborne, C.S. Osborne & Co. has been a beacon of excellence in tool manufacturing for nearly two centuries. From its humble beginnings serving harness makers and saddlers to becoming a global leader in the industry, the company’s legacy is a testament to innovation, quality, and unwavering dedication to craftsmanship.

Fun Facts About Crawford County, AR
- County Seat: Van Buren
- Year Established: October 18, 1820
- Formed from: Pulaski County
- Etymology: William H. Crawford (1772–1834), a politician who served as Secretary of the Treasury and Secretary of War
- Time Zone: America/Chicago
- Population: 61946
- Land Area Sq Km: 1565
- Land Area Sq Mi: 604.2
